Tata Steel, part of the Tata Steel Group, is one
of the world's largest steel producers, with a
combined presence in nearly 50 countries.
Tata Steel is a leading supplier to many of
the most demanding markets around the
world including: Aerospace, Automotive,
Construction, Consumer Products, Energy
& Power Generation, Engineering, Metal
Goods, Oil & Gas, Packaging, Rail and
Security & Defence.
The Tata Steel Vision
Tata Steel is used globally in projects such
as the Bugatti Veyron, the Delhi Metro and
the Petronas Towers. During South Africa's
preparations for the 2010 Football World Cup,
Tata Steel was included in the construction
of the new King Shaka International Airport
at Durban. Closer to home we have won
contracts for the 2012 Olympic games and
our metal has been used in the new Wembley
Stadium, track for the London Underground
and the London Eye.

Tata Steel Training and Development
Tata Steel has the size and diversity to
tailor careers by providing real life projects
from the outset and challenges that will be
interesting, dynamic and relevant to the
business. Those entering the company receive
on the job and formal training designed to
develop management and technical skills.
Our structured training ensures knowledge
of products, Tata Steel as a whole and the
function through rotational placements
alongside normal ongoing career progression.
However, the training will not stop there.
Tata Steel is committed to Professional
Accreditation, providing a professional
mentor and training that will support you
in becoming chartered with the appropriate
professional body (e.g. IMechE, IET, ICE,
IoM3, CIPD, CIMA etc).
The Tata Steel Package
The starting package includes competitive
salary, interest free loan, pension scheme
membership and 25 days holiday (+ bank
holidays).
